The father of a three-year-old boy that was killed in the Barcelona attack shared a tender moment with Rubi's imam.
An emotional protest against terrorism took place yesterday (August 25) in the Spanish town of Rubi, near Barcelona.
In attendance were the parents of three-year-old Xavi Martínez, who lost his life in the terrorist attack on Las Ramblas avenue in central Barcelona last week.
Xavi’s father Javier shared a tender moment with the local imam, Dris Salym, who started crying as the pair hugged.
The three-year-old was walking down Las Ramblas with other members of his family when a van ploughed into pedestrians killing him and 12 others.
